Output ec3fd65e9e25715c5866df7ec3a296fcfe6d8fc02675a4efc5bcb791e6fd3f21:2

value
494700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d3dbf438634015d934ae7eeca2605c5830795c8 OP_EQUAL
address
3AC2jecm5DE6a9mLfLHobnJet1SHmjLHLk
transaction
ec3fd65e9e25715c5866df7ec3a296fcfe6d8fc02675a4efc5bcb791e6fd3f21
spent
true